Company Information
Hostelling International (HI) has over 4,000 unique hostels in 90 countries worldwide, located in some of the world’s most inspiring locations. Through nearly 70 Youth Hostel Associations, HI currently provides 38 million overnight stays a year, many of which are booked through the hihostels.com website. With over 4 million members worldwide HI is one of the largest youth membership organisations in the world. HI is a non-profit membership organisation, with a proud history and a relevant philosophy. Our mission is to promote cultural education, peace and international understanding through travel - offering affordable, safe, quality accommodation to people of all ages, races, religions and nationalities.
Job Description
HIhostels.com is the core marketing and booking mechanism for HI and currently receives around a million visitors and 5 million page views per month. The site is available in 4 languages (with more on the way) and is a key revenue-generator for the organisation and National Associations. Having conducted an SEO audit and developed an SEO strategy with an external search consultant, HI are now dedicated to improving the site’s search traffic, and are currently expanding the team to carry out a complete, holistic search marketing programme over the next 12 months (and beyond).
The Online Marketing Assistant will be heavily involved in implementing search activities, with a focus on linkbuilding and social media. As one of the first search-related posts within the business, the role is an initial 12-month contract which may extend/evolve after the search programme is up and running.
